A management accountant is required for a 6 month, fixed term contract to support the integration of a recently acquired business. Reporting to the Head of Finance, the management accountant will be responsible for the preparation of management accounts and several other reports, whilst working closely with budget holders to provide analysis. This role combines financial, analytical and management skills to aid management with decision making.Duties include;* Month end review and reporting, including P&L and Balance Sheet* Control and preparation of general ledger entries including prepayments, accruals, deferred income, and allocations* Support Cashflow reporting, forecasting and monitoring* Own the month-end actuals process for the various lines, ensuring accurate financial statements and providing insightful commentary on variances to Budget and Last Year* Collaborate with Budget Holders to manage costs, reviewing spend regularly and challenging where necessary to keep  costs within Budget* Support Budget Holders by providing ad hoc analysis to help them understand their spend and identify opportunities to reduce costs and improve efficiency* Assist in managing the Group budget, accurately tracking spend and headcount* Prepare monthly forecasts and annual budgets for the business areas and provide reporting on actuals vs. Budget and Last YearInterested candidates should be qualified - CIMA/ACA/ACCA or equivalent, coupled with relevant experience. In addition, you will possess experience of working with an ERP system, coupled with strong Excel skills.This role is due to start imminently, so you will be available at short notice.In return, a competitive salary and benefits package is offered, including; life assurance, income protection, pension. Other benefits will be applicable after a qualifying period, including private medical, health cash plan and a flexible benefits allowance.
